Know before you go
Hi, I'm Eve. Here are a few practical things to know before exploring Kennisis Lake.
- Visit during sunrise or sunset for breathtaking views and incredible photo opportunities.
- Consider renting a kayak or canoe to explore the hidden coves and serene waters of the lake.
- Pack a picnic to enjoy by the lakeside and take advantage of the beautiful natural scenery.
- Check local regulations for fishing and boating permits before planning your visit.
- Be prepared for varying weather conditions; layering your clothing is recommended for comfort.

Getting There
-
Car
If you're driving from Haliburton village, head northwest on County Road 21. Continue on County Road 21 for about 15 kilometers. You'll pass through the scenic countryside. Keep an eye out for Kennisis Lake Road on your left. Turn onto Kennisis Lake Road and follow it until you reach the lake. There are several access points to the lake, so look for parking areas along the road. Be aware that parking might be limited during peak tourist season, and there could be a small parking fee.
-
Public Transportation
Public transportation options to Kennisis Lake are limited. You can take a bus from Haliburton to the nearest stop on County Road 21. From there, you would need to arrange for a taxi or rideshare service to take you the remaining distance to Kennisis Lake Road. Make sure to check the local bus schedule ahead of time, as services may not run frequently. Additionally, be prepared for taxi costs that can vary based on distance.
-
Bicycle
For those who enjoy biking, you can rent a bicycle in Haliburton and take the scenic route to Kennisis Lake. Head northwest on County Road 21, following the same path as cars. The ride is approximately 15 kilometers and can take around 1 hour depending on your cycling speed. Be sure to wear a helmet and follow the rules of the road. Keep in mind that there are some hilly areas along the route.
